        So I finished installing everything. I ended up keeping the wiring the same as it seems to be working.
        The interior was put together well, I was ready to burn down a kindergarten after trying to put the rear seats back in with those child seat locks. So painful.

        The wiring went like this from the battery - across the back of the engine bay behind the firewall insulation, down through the clutch pedal hole (DSG) and then along the door sills to the back. I ran the RCA cables and the remote wire along there as well. No issues with noise interference yet.

        After an excellent tip from VW_Tim I ran the wire from the fuse box which means no cables show in the engine bay which is really awesome.

        I mounted the amp upside down - I read how this is bad for the amp as the heat rises up into the electronics. However when I opened up the amp it was actually mounted on the top half so I figured it wouldn't make much different.
